Nathan MacKinnon, Drew Doughty & Steven Stamkos


Nathan Mackinnon (15:00) addresses the Nikita Zadorov comments from the summer, the importance of Gabriel Landeskog to the Avalanche, the process in Colorado, how he overcomes the feeling of being hesitant on the ice, and he tells the guys about an interesting line he played against this summer (that we could potentially see at the Olympics). Drew Doughty (30:00) tells Jeff and Elliotte how it feels to be gunning for the Stanley Cup playoffs this season, his determination to make the Olympic team, what he would like to do post-career, the excitement to finally have fans back in arenas, and he clears the air around a certain story from the 2010 Olympics. Back-to-back Stanley Cup champion Steven Stamkos (45:30) explains the hunger in last years Lightning team, if he considered retirement at any point over the last few seasons, the frustration of not being able to leave the Bell Centre after game 5, adding Corey Perry to the group, and his thoughts on Nikita Kucherov’s post-game press conference after they won the Stanley Cup last season.
